Someone Killed an Entire Family of Beautiful Swans — And They Are Still on the Loose

The small village Benenden in Kent has become the scene of a brutal crime.

Late last month, police were called to investigate a murder. An entire family had been riddled with bullets, stuffed in plastic bags and left for dead. The victims, two adult swans and their five cygnets were waiting to be found on the edge of a river bank — tossed like trash when just hours ago they had been alive.

Authorities were shocked at the horrific scene and after recovering the bodies and conducting an X-ray it was clear what had happened. Someone or perhaps more than one had taken an air rifle and decided to use the family of swans for target practice.

These air rifle/bb guns have become a serious threat to animal safety. According to the RSPCA, they received "884 calls reporting airgun attacks on animals across England and Wales last year" — 51 of which were from Kent County — the second highest in the nation.
